Internet Explorer 7 SUCKED (for me).. anyone else have a problem w/it?
I have Windows XP... I "upgraded" from IE version 6 to version 7, and the browser kept crashing EVRYTIME I tried to go to a web page. It was horrible... I had to keep rebooting my system because after the browser froze, the other programs running didn't run well... I uninstalled it and then my iexplorer.exe "disappeared", my quick launch icons were gone.... Internet Explorer 6 went MIA, though it was still somewhere in my Windows OS. I tried various fixes on the Microsoft web site-- ended up reinstalling version 7 because version 6 is not downloadable (part of Windows), and ended up unistalling IE 7 over and over with each attept to correct the problem...

I am not an IT genius, and it took me some time to figure out how to get my old version of Inernet Explorer back (Control Panel and then re-install Windows Programs icon).... YECH. Watta a frigging piece of shit browser- for me. Anyone else have a problem with it?
